Q: Is 402,334,022 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 402,334,022 is a composite number.

Why is 402,334,022 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 402,334,022 can be evenly divided by 1 2 577 1,154 348,643 697,286 201,167,011 and 402,334,022, with no remainder.

Since 402,334,022 cannot be divided by just 1 and 402,334,022, it is a composite number.
